In simple termsThe flat cut brisket, also called the first cut, the lean flat muscle seamed off a boneless brisket. The cleaner half of the brisket, preferred for deli slicing programs, sliced corned beef, and pastrami. Main muscle: pectoralis profundi.

USDA spec

Individual muscle. May be prepared from any IMPS boneless brisket item; consists only of the M. pectoralis profundi. All surfaces trimmed practically free of fat. No less than 1/2-inch thick at any point.

Where does the brisket, point/off, bnls price come from?

Wholesale beef brisket, point/off, bnls is priced FOB plant in cents per pound and reported daily by USDA AMS as part of the National Daily Boxed Beef Cutout, Negotiated Sales (LM_XB403) report. Prices reflect weighted-average negotiated trades for delivery within 0-21 days.

What does IMPS 120A mean?

IMPS 120A is the USDA Institutional Meat Purchase Specifications code for Beef Brisket, Flat Cut, Boneless (IM). It's the standard spec used in wholesale trading and procurement contracts.

About this cut

The breast section of the steer, made of the deep pectoral (the flat) and the superficial pectoral (the point). Tough until slow-cooked. Central to Texas barbecue, pastrami, and corned beef. Boneless.
